Background technology
Immersible pump is that the pump housing and motor all pull the plug a kind of water pump of work, is the important equipment of deep-well water lift, leads to
Cross and stretch into cable in well and power to motor, eliminate transmission long axis, have it is compact-sized, it is light-weight, install, use and shift
The advantages of facilitating, be mainly used in mine speedily carry out rescue work, industry cooling, field irrigation, seawater lift, steamer tune load, fountain landscape etc.
Aspect, must be hydraulically full in suction line and pump before immersible pump turn on pump.After turn on pump, impeller high speed rotation, liquid therein with
Blade rotates together, under the influence of centrifugal force, flies away from impeller and projects outward, the liquid of injection in pump case diffuser casing speed by
Gradual change is slow, and pressure gradually increases, then from pump discharge, discharge pipe outflow.
With the rapid development of pump industry, the structure of immersible pump is constantly improved in production is practical so that diving
The performance of pump is greatly improved, and existing immersible pump all improves the acceleration of fluid using multistage diffuser mostly, by
Too many in diffuser series, pump all drives operating using independent impeller axle mostly, impeller axle by common shaft coupling and
Motor shaft is connected, and since motor shaft and impeller axle powder are set up, can there is bounce axially and radially, lead to the biography of shaft coupling
Turn is changed less efficient, while can also generate larger noise.
